France Faces Political Upheaval as National Rally Gains Momentum
Snap elections and rising far-right support challenge Macron's leadership and reshape French politics
- President Macron's snap election call has triggered a major political crisis in France.
- Marine Le Pen's National Rally is poised to potentially secure an absolute majority in parliament.
- The centre-right Republicans are fractured, while the left-wing New Popular Front struggles with internal divisions.
- Anti-Semitic incidents and debates over immigration heighten tensions across the country.
